Council members directed staff to send a letter to King County Metro asking it to reconsider termination of the MetroFlex Juanita response zone and to explore expanding outreach and coordination with Bothell on first-mile/last-mile service.

Bothell City Council members on July 1 agreed that King County Metro should be asked to pause any decision to end the MetroFlex Juanita response zone and to discuss options before a final decision is made. City staff presented a draft letter and asked the council whether it wanted the city to send it to King County Metro.
